Yes, the M38A1CDN was built by Ford Canada. Not sure of the production run total but it probably started very late 1952 and ran into late 1953. I think the only facility they were still operating out of at that time was their Windsor, Ontario site. They did open a facility of Oakville, Ontario in the 1950's, I think, but I do not know if it was production or admin related.
